Tolerance Backward Propagation Based on Manufacturing Difficulties in Computer-aided Tolerance Design

摘要

The interval constraint can be applied in tolerance design iftolerances are considered as interval, and backward propagation can be used to realize tolerance synthesis in which tolerances are allocated to meet functional requirements. The intervals are tightened uniformly or according to interval width or nominal value of dimension in previous methods. A tolerance backward propagation method based on manufacturing difficulties is presented in this paper. In the new arithmetic, the interval is tightened according to the manufacturing difficulty of the interval. So it will be easy to manufacture and has lower manufacturing cost. Finally, the proposed arithmetic is tested on a practical example.
